Forensic Context

A study in severely injured human patients identified 69 differentially expressed microRNAs, with the mir-199b showing an indirect correlation with arterial blood gas PaCO2 levels [Uhlich et al. DOI:10.1016/j.surg.2014.06.017]. In a separate study on human sepsis, RNA-seq analysis identified the mir-199b as part of a constructed competing endogenous RNA network, where it was predicted to interact with TGFBR3 [Zhang et al. DOI:10.1186/s12920-023-01460-8]. A study in mice demonstrated that the mir-199b was a predictive biomarker for survival, with lower circulating abundance associated with reduced survival in C3H mice at day 2 post whole thorax irradiation, and it was also differentially expressed in C3H heart tissue [Rogers et al. DOI:10.1371/journal.pone.0232411]. In human sepsis research, hsa-miR-199b-5p was identified as a differentially expressed microRNA upregulated in sepsis patients compared to healthy controls [Li et al. DOI:10.1038/s41598-025-89946-6].
